Biomaterial implants and devices increase the risk of microbial infections due to the biofilm mode of growth of infecting bacteria on implant materials, in which bacteria are protected against antibiotic treatment and the local immune system. The implantation of biomaterials into the human body has become an indispensable part of almost all fields of modern medicine. Accordingly, there is an increasing need for appropriate approaches, which can be used to evaluate the suitability of different biomaterials for distinct clinical indications. During the 1960s and 1970s, a first generation of materials was specially developed for use inside the human body. These developments became the basis for the field of biomaterials. The devices made from biomaterials are called prostheses.
